The connection between a child’s jaw development, their breathing, and their sleep is well established — yet it is often underappreciated in routine dental and medical care. A narrow palate, a mouth-breathing habit, or a jaw pattern that constricts the upper airway can affect a child’s sleep quality, growth, development, concentration, and long-term health in ways that go far beyond the orthodontic problem itself.
For most children, we recommend a first orthodontic evaluation by the age of 7. Where airway or sleep-disordered breathing concerns are present, however, earlier assessment is sometimes warranted — and should not be postponed. Simply waiting while a child is not breathing or sleeping well is not a neutral decision. The early years of life are critical for neurocognitive development, learning, behaviour, and growth; a child who is not sleeping well due to a structural problem is being deprived of the conditions they need to develop optimally during a window that cannot be recovered. Orthodontic interventions such as palatal expansion can act as an important adjunct to comprehensive airway management — and the earlier these are identified and addressed, the greater the benefit to the child’s development and long-term health.

Childhood is the period of maximum jaw growth and adaptability. The forces that act on the developing jaws — including the resting position of the tongue, the pattern of breathing, and the functional habits of swallowing and chewing — directly influence the shape and size of the arches and the direction of jaw growth. This means that airway problems and jaw development problems are not separate issues: they are frequently the same problem, viewed from different angles.
Mouth breathing. When a child breathes habitually through the mouth — whether due to nasal obstruction, enlarged adenoids or tonsils, a narrow palate, or learned habit — the tongue rests low in the mouth rather than against the palate. This removes one of the most important natural stimuli for upper jaw development, allowing the arch to narrow and the palate to rise. Over time, this pattern can lead to a progressively narrower airway, a longer face, crowded teeth, and a worsening of the very nasal obstruction that started the cycle.
Sleep-disordered breathing. Snoring, obstructive sleep apnoea, and upper airway resistance syndrome occur in children as well as adults, and the consequences for a developing child are particularly significant. Poor sleep quality in children is associated with attention and behaviour problems, difficulties at school, growth impairment, and long-term cardiovascular and metabolic health risks. Where orthodontic factors are contributing to a child’s sleep difficulties, early intervention can have effects that extend far beyond the teeth.
The growth window. Problems that contribute to airway dysfunction — a narrow palate, a retrognathic lower jaw, a class III skeletal pattern — can be addressed more readily, more effectively, and with greater long-term stability during childhood than at any other time. The same interventions that require surgery in adults can often be achieved entirely non-surgically in a growing child.
Widening the upper jaw is the most direct orthodontic intervention with airway benefit in children. Because the floor of the nose sits directly above the palate, expanding the palate widens the nasal passage — increasing nasal airflow and reducing the resistance that drives mouth breathing. In children with nasal obstruction related to a narrow palate, palatal expansion can restore nasal breathing with a lasting effect.
Where the expansion is coordinated with ENT assessment and management of any concurrent nasal pathology (such as adenoidal hypertrophy or turbinate enlargement), the combined benefit is substantially greater than either intervention alone.
In children with a class III skeletal pattern — where the upper jaw is underdeveloped — the tongue base and soft palate may be positioned in a way that narrows the nasopharyngeal airway. Advancing the upper jaw with facemask therapy improves the mid-facial skeleton and may have a beneficial effect on the upper airway dimensions in these children, in addition to correcting the bite.
In children with a significant overjet and a retrognathic lower jaw, the position of the tongue base and the pharyngeal airway space may be unfavourable. Aligners with mandibular advancement features encourage the lower jaw into a more forward position during wear, which can have a beneficial effect on the airway dimensions, while simultaneously reducing the overjet and the risk of dental trauma.

Where a child presents with signs of nasal obstruction, mouth breathing, or disturbed sleep, ENT assessment is recommended as a routine part of the workup, alongside the orthodontic assessment. In many cases, the most effective approach involves addressing both the structural (orthodontic) and the soft tissue (ENT) components of the problem simultaneously or in a carefully coordinated sequence.

In many children with mouth breathing and airway concerns, abnormal tongue posture and oral habits — such as a low resting tongue position, a tongue thrust swallowing pattern, or persistent thumb or finger sucking — are identified alongside the structural problem. These habits perpetuate the narrow arch and the mouth-breathing pattern even after orthodontic or ENT treatment has been completed, and addressing them is essential for long-term stability.
Myofunctional therapy retrains the tongue, lip, and facial muscles to adopt a more functional resting position and movement pattern — restoring nasal breathing, correcting tongue posture, and a healthy swallowing pattern. In children, this therapy is most effective when delivered in conjunction with orthodontic treatment, as the structural changes created by expansion provide the physical space the tongue needs to rest in the correct position.

Some children do improve spontaneously, particularly if adenoids and tonsils reduce in size with age. However, where structural factors — a narrow palate, a class III jaw relationship — are contributing, these will not resolve without intervention. An orthodontic assessment does not commit to treatment; it provides information that allows an informed decision to be made about whether and when to act.
